Throttle's Software Plugins and VSTs
In the YouTube video "How I made 'Found You (Make Me Yours)'," Throttle demonstrates using the Lennar Digital Sylenth1 Software Synthesizer right at the beginning.

At 3:05 when talking about using a vocoder, Throttle refers to routing Serum chords through it. At 4:41 when talking about chords, Serum is brought up and Throttle says "Just Serum chords... Quite basic, just three voices with a bit of detune and the main thing going here is the phaser... and then reverb and EQ... the flanger is doing a decent amount too." When asked if he uses a lot of Serum, Throttle responded "Yeah, I've been diving back into Serum and Sylenth a lot"
At 18:40 when discussing the drop in this track, Icarus can be seen as one of the layers.
At 24:45 while discussing strings, RC-20 is brought up and Throttle says "It gets rid of that harsh high end".
